最新フレームワーク「Vercel v0」がもたらす新常識
「Webサイトやアプリケーションをもっとサクサク動かしたい」「開発スピードを上げたいけれど、どこに手を付ければいいかわからない」そんな疑問や不安を抱えていませんか?
この記事では、Vercel v0という新しいフレームワークが、あなたのWeb開発を次のレベルへ導いてくれる理由を徹底解説します。
この記事を読むメリット
- 「v0」という名前の“意外な”最新フレームワークが何なのか理解できる
- 高速なビルド・デプロイの仕組みや、サイトを瞬時にプレビューする方法がわかる
- Eコマースやブログ、企業サイトなど、多彩な活用事例から具体的に導入イメージをつかめる
- 料金プランや導入手順まで押さえられるので、すぐに試し始められる
「v0ってなんだか古いバージョンみたいで不安……」と思う方もいるかもしれません。実は、Vercelにおける“v0”は“次世代の最先端フレームワーク”を意味しているのです。名前のギャップに驚く方も多いのですが、そこにこそVercelの大胆なコンセプトや開発チームの情熱が詰まっています。気になっていた方はぜひ最後までご覧いただき、あなたのWeb開発に取り入れるヒントを見つけてみてください。
Vercel v0とは?
Vercel v0は、Webサイトやアプリケーションを素早く構築・プレビュー・デプロイするための次世代フレームワークです。
- 従来のv1ではNext.jsのSSR(サーバーサイドレンダリング)が中心でしたが、v0ではSSG(静的サイト生成)やISR(インクリメンタルな静的再生成)を強化。
- 幅広いユースケースに対応することで、開発者の生産性を高め、ユーザーエクスペリエンスを最適化します。
「SSRだけではカバーできないかも…」「高速なサイトが作りたいけど設定が大変じゃない?」と悩む方にとって、v0はその答えになり得る存在です。
v0の主な機能と利点
1. 高速なビルドとデプロイ
- SSRとISRのサポートにより、プロジェクトの性質に合わせた最適なレンダリング手法を選べます。
- 変更があった部分だけ素早くビルドし、最新コンテンツを即座に公開可能。
- ビルド・デプロイ時間を大幅に短縮でき、リリースサイクルを加速します。
2. シームレスなプレビュー
- リアルタイムで変更を確認しながら開発が進められるので、デザインやコードのフィードバックが素早く得られる。
- チームメンバーやクライアントとのやりとりがスムーズになります。
3. 最適化されたパフォーマンス
- 自動画像最適化、エッジキャッシング、CDN配信など、サイト表示速度を高める機能を標準搭載。
- 地理的に離れたユーザーにも、遅延の少ない快適な体験を提供。
- パフォーマンスの向上がSEOにも良い影響を及ぼし、ユーザーの離脱率を低減。
4. 柔軟なルーティング
- ファイルシステムベースのルーティングを採用し、複雑な設定なしでサイト構造を管理可能。
- 大規模サイトでも見通しが良く、開発効率を下げません。
5. サーバーレス関数の強力なサポート
- Next.jsのAPIルート、Edge Functionsなど、多彩なサーバーレス関数を利用可能。
- インフラ管理不要で、外部API連携やデータベース操作など、柔軟なバックエンド機能を簡単に実装。
- v0ではサーバーレス関数のさらなるアップデートも予定されており、より高度な要件にも対応可能に。
v0の活用事例
1. Eコマースサイト
- 高速読み込みとスムーズな操作性は、ユーザーの購買意欲を左右する重要ポイント。
- ある事例では、v0に移行することでページ読み込み速度が30%向上し、コンバージョン率が15%増加したという報告も。
2. ブログやニュースサイト
- 更新頻度が高いため、ビルドとデプロイのスピードが運営コストを左右。
- v0を導入したニュースサイトでは、記事公開時間を50%短縮し、鮮度の高い情報をいち早く届けられるように。
3. 企業Webサイト
- ブランドイメージを伝えるためには、洗練されたデザインと快適なユーザー体験が欠かせません。
- v0の画像最適化やエッジキャッシングによって、見た目と速度の両立が可能です。
4. Webアプリケーション
- インタラクティブなUIや複雑なロジックにも対応できる柔軟性。
- サーバーレス関数を活用すれば、チャットボットやリアルタイム分析などもスピーディに構築できます。
v0の制限事項
メリットの多いv0ですが、いくつか注意点も存在します。
- コールドスタート
- サーバーレス関数を初回呼び出し時に、コンテナ起動などで処理に遅延が発生する可能性があります。
- ベンダーロックイン
- Vercelのプラットフォームに依存するため、他サービスへ移行する際にはリソース再構築やコード修正が必要になる場合があります。
- 学習コスト
- Next.jsやサーバーレス技術に関する知識が必要。
- ただし公式ドキュメントは充実しており、コミュニティによる情報も豊富です。
v0の利用方法
- Vercelアカウントを作成
- Vercel公式サイトにアクセスしてアカウントを登録。
- プロジェクトを作成
- Vercelダッシュボードから新規プロジェクトを立ち上げます。
- コードをデプロイ
- Gitリポジトリを接続し、Vercelで自動ビルド&デプロイ。
- ドメインを設定
- カスタムドメインを紐づければ、独自のURLでサイトを公開可能。
- Webサイト/アプリケーションを公開
- ビルド後、すぐに世界中のユーザーに高速配信できます。
v0の料金体系
- 無料プラン
- 個人プロジェクトや小規模サイト向け。
- v0の基本的な機能を試すのに十分なリソースが用意されている。
- 有料プラン
- エンタープライズレベルのプロジェクトに対応できる充実したリソース。
- チーム開発に役立つコラボレーション機能やサポート体制も強化。
詳しい料金やプラン内容はVercelの公式サイトで確認できます。
まとめ
Vercel v0は、Web開発において高速なビルド&デプロイやシームレスなプレビュー、最適化されたパフォーマンスなど、魅力的な機能を多数備えた“最新かつ画期的”なフレームワークです。
- Eコマースからブログ、企業サイト、Webアプリケーションに至るまで、多岐にわたる用途でその能力を発揮。
- コミュニティからのフィードバックを取り入れ、開発ワークフローの改善とパフォーマンス向上を追求しており、今後の拡張にも期待できます。
「名前からしてちょっと古そう……」と敬遠していた方も、v0の最新機能を知れば考え方が変わるはずです。高品質なユーザー体験を提供したい、プロジェクトの開発・運用効率を上げたいという方は、この機会にぜひVercel v0を検討してみてください。あなたのWeb開発が、驚くほどスムーズかつパワフルなものへと生まれ変わるでしょう。